Increased virulence of Italian infectious hematopoietic necrosis virus (IHNV) associated with the emergence of new strains
7 Jun 2021
Abstract excerpt
Abstract Infectious hematopoietic necrosis virus (IHNV) is the causative agent of IHN triggering a systemic syndrome in salmonid fish. Although IHNV has always been associated with low levels of mortality in Italian trout farming industries, in the last years trout farmers have experienced severe disease outbreaks.
